Output eebc495efd139696876ea757624c48c271a546ff0c001f84cee88911ee893ef7:2

value
2641061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53360f831459d8b694dddd2cd84fd436c68d003c OP_EQUALVERIFY OP_CHECKSIG
address
18ayr7qQRfsa58mjgh8F6TfP3JHXoPhUJW
transaction
eebc495efd139696876ea757624c48c271a546ff0c001f84cee88911ee893ef7
spent
true